Building a Financial Fortress: Safeguarding Against Unexpected Expenses

Life is full of surprises, some joyous and others unexpected. While we can't control unforeseen circumstances, we can armor ourselves financially to weather any turmoil. This means developing a financial fortress, a solid foundation built on discipline and designed to absorb the impact of unexpected expenses.

A key component of this fortress is an emergency fund, a dedicated pool of cash set aside specifically for unforeseen situations. This buffer can help you avoid financial hardship when faced with unforeseen costs.

Building this financial fortress is an ongoing process, and it requires a proactive approach. Start by assessing your current spending habits, identify areas where you can minimize on expenses, and set realistic savings goals.

Unlocking Financial Freedom: Tips for Lasting Wealth and Security

Building lasting wealth demands a combination of smart decisions and consistent effort. It's not about getting rich quick but rather cultivating a secure financial future that provides peace of mind. One crucial step is creating a comprehensive budget which your income and expenses meticulously. This allows you to identify areas where you can reduce spending and allocate funds towards investments.

Diversifying your investments is another key factor in achieving financial freedom. Don't put all your eggs in one basket; explore a range of options such as stocks, bonds, real estate, and even alternative investments like gold or cryptocurrencies. Remember to investigate each option thoroughly before making any commitments.

Furthermore, consistently educating yourself about personal finance is vital. Remain up-to-date on market trends, investment strategies, and financial planning techniques. There are countless resources available, from books and articles to online courses and seminars.

Lastly, foster a long-term mindset. Building wealth is a marathon, not a sprint. Be patient, persistent and stay focused on your goals. Remember that consistency and discipline are key ingredients in unlocking financial freedom.
